National Lacrosse League Announces Full Schedule 2021-22

PHILADELPHIA, September 29, 2021 – The National Lacrosse League (@NLL), the largest and most successful professional lacrosse league in the world, today announced its full schedule for 2021-22, beginning with the Face Off Weekend December 3-4. Early highlights of the list include the Vancouver Warriors’ first standalone contest at the San Diego Seals on Friday, December 3rd; a 2019 NLL Finals rematch between the Calgary Roughnecks and Buffalo Bandits in Buffalo on Saturday December 4th; first game in Fort Worth, Texas (December 10th) and the return of the NLL to Hamilton, Ontario (December 4th) and Albany, New York (December 18th).

Each team will play nine home and nine away games during the season. TSN will broadcast a regular season of “Game of the Week” on linear television and broadcast each regular season game on its digital platforms, the TSN app or TSN.ca. Further broadcast networks and schedules will be announced shortly.

In addition to the Warriors Seals lid lifter, the Calgary Buffalo rematch, and the renewal of many classic rivalries, some of the notable competitions that NLL fans will have on their calendars include:

  • Saturday, December 4th, Albany FireWolves at Toronto Rock, first game at Hamilton’s FirstOntario Center since the Ontario Raiders in 1998 and first game for the relocated Albany franchise
  • Saturday, December 4th, Panther City Lacrosse Club in Philadelphia Wings, opening competition for the Panther City expansion
  • Saturday, December 4th, Saskatchewan Rush at the Halifax Thunderbirds, a remake of their 2019-20 classic matchup that ended in overtime with a 16-15 win for the Rush.
  • Friday, December 10th, Vancouver Warriors at Panther City Lacrosse Club, first home game in Fort Worth and first NLL game in Texas
  • Saturday, December 11th, Calgary Roughnecks at Saskatchewan Rush and Buffalo Bandits at Rochester Knighthawks, in the first of three matchups of the season between these division rivals
  • Friday, December 17th, San Diego Seals at Calgary Roughnecks, return leg for 13-year-old Roughneck and former MVP Dane Dobbie with his new team
  • Saturday December 18, Rochester Knighthawks at Albany FireWolves, first game in Albany since the Albany attack in 2003 for the relocated FireWolves franchise
  • Saturday February 5th and Saturday March 19th Georgia Swarm at Albany FireWolves return to Albany with outstanding results from the University at Albany Miles Thompson and Lyle Thompson
  • Saturday, March 26th, New York Riptide at Albany FireWolves, returning from Callum Crawford to his previous franchise, where he led the team for the past two seasons and had a top division .727 win percentage in the 2019-20 season
  • Saturday April 2, Buffalo Bandits at the Colorado Mammoth features the number one and two matchup of the ranked goalkeepers (Matt Vinc and Dillon Ward) according to the NLLPA player survey
  • In Week 22, the final week of the regular season April 29-30, each team will be taking action in conference matches, with many potential playoff seeding positions at stake

About the National Lacrosse League

The National Lacrosse League (NLL) is North America’s premier professional lacrosse league. Founded in 1986, the NLL ranks third in the world in terms of average attendance in professional indoor sports, only behind the NHL and the NBA. The league consists of 15 franchises in the US and Canada: Albany FireWolves, Buffalo Bandits, Calgary Roughnecks, Colorado Mammoth, Georgia Swarm, Halifax Thunderbirds, Las Vegas NLL, New York Riptide, Panther City Lacrosse Club (TX), Philadelphia Wings, Rochester Knighthawks, San Diego Seals, Saskatchewan Rush, Toronto Rock, and Vancouver Warriors.
